yt-dlp / Deno

インストール

  • apache から呼び出せるよう system-wide でインストールする
  • デフォルトオプションを記述した yt-dlp.conf の実ファイルは /path/to/yt-dlp.conf に配置し、シンボリックリンクを実行ファイルと同じディレクトリに配置する
  • Deno についても system-wide でインストールする
    # curl -L https://github.com/yt-dlp/yt-dlp/releases/latest/download/yt-dlp -o /usr/local/bin/yt-dlp
    # chmod a+rx /usr/local/bin/yt-dlp
    # ln -s /path/to/yt-dlp.conf /usr/local/bin/
    # curl -fsSL https://deno.land/install.sh | DENO_INSTALL=/usr/local sh

更新

  • 自己更新オプション有り
    # yt-dlp -U
    # deno upgrade

アンインストール

  • Deno 依存ファイル/キャッシュのパスの確認
    # deno info
  • 実行ファイル削除
    # rm -f /usr/local/bin/yt-dlp /usr/local/bin/deno
  • Deno 依存ファイル/キャッシュの削除
    # rm -rf ~/.cache/deno